Output 66b5f749b936db2866b5947215b76723d53215bcec931478fb61038b1f43208c:7

value
4621113
script pubkey
OP_0 OP_PUSHBYTES_32 8feaa5afe828ca1362ea3711ef304244cf1a17f0deeceb93fac1df5e5d03f15e
address
bc1q3l42ttlg9r9pxch2xug77vzzgn8359lsmmkwhyl6c804uhgr790q0qqput
transaction
66b5f749b936db2866b5947215b76723d53215bcec931478fb61038b1f43208c